Most GM vehicles built in the last 20+ years have a theft deterrent system, that includes the Chevy Impala. Depending on the model year, your car's theft deterrent system disables the fuel pump, ignitions system, or starter if unauthorized access is detected. Nov 8, 2022 · A Service Theft Deterrent System is a technology activated to prevent car theft after being triggered by a break-in attempt. The system utilizes external and internal car sensors to detect attempts of breaking in. The usual break-in attempts happen on door locks and windows. When the system is triggered, it will immobilize the engine and ...

GM vehicles have three types of Vehicle Thief Deterrent (VTD) systems, each requiring their own set of relearn procedures. Unless these procedures are correctly performed the vehicle will not start after the PCM has been replaced. It is possible that another RFID device may interfere with the Passkey system. The range of the interference can vary based on the strength of the RFID which may affect the key to exciter module communication. As the window is important for deterring theft and protecting you from the weather... positive reinforcement classroom management Jun 30, 2022 · The average cost for a Chevrolet Malibu Antitheft System Control Module Replacement is between $212 and $249. Labor costs are estimated between $141 and $178 while parts are priced between $71 and $71. Your location and vehicle may affect the price of Antitheft System Control Module Replacement.
